Anyway heard this horror story from a fellow colleague today and thought that you all might wanna know and be careful when buying motor insurance...she changed car recently and her car dealer told her about his experience...
He bought from this company, well-known for cheap premiums but hard to claim, and had a minor accident one day. So he had to sent it to the stipulated workshop. When he went to collect his car, he was given a form to sign to collect his car. Since the insurance company is so well-known so he thought their workshop should be alright also...so he just sign and left. Halfway through, he just felt something funny when driving his car. He got off and realize his tire has been changed and certain of his car parts were changed too...not to more expensive one, but to cheaper ones. He had no case against them as he had signed the forms and collected his car and left...anyone heard of this kind of experience before???
Anyway my colleague went on to explain that the cheap premiums is possible for motor insurance with specified workshop because they give the rights to workshop that give the lowest quote for repair. And to make money, it's possible that they might do funny things to your car to make money...
Moral of the story - always check before you sign anything no matter what you do...
